Bad Rabbit Ransomware – What is it and how to stay safe

Credit to Author: Trend Micro| Date: Fri, 27 Oct 2017 16:50:50 +0000

Trend Micro is tracking multiple reports of ransomware infections, known as Bad Rabbit, in many countries around the world. A suspected variant of Petya, Bad Rabbit is ransomware—malicious software that infects a computer and restricts user access to the infected machine until a ransom is paid to unlock it.
